In New Outlook for Windows, moving email messages between separate accounts is blocked by default whenever a work or school account is involved. This behavior is part of the application’s security design and is intended to help protect organizational data from being transferred between accounts without the appropriate authorization.
Although you may have administrator privileges, these permissions do not automatically enable the feature. Administrator access and the security setting that controls cross-account message transfers are managed separately. As a result, the restriction may remain in place even when you are signed in as an administrator.
